The mobile computing world continues to expand, and mobile websites and mobile apps will continue to rise in popularity. The undergraduate certificate in mobile computing from American Public University (APU) offers a useful education in mobile computing basics, including website and application design, development, testing, and implementation.
You’ll also learn best practices and procedures for utilizing the iterative process and deploying mobile applications in Apple iOS and Android platform environments and mobile devices.
Through your online mobile computing classes, you’ll explore the rapid evolution of mobile computing and the impact mobile technology has in advancing systems, communications, and societies worldwide. You’ll add to your expertise with programming languages and object-oriented programming languages.
What You Will Do
- Understand the benefits of designing and developing mobile application software to support mobile computing devices
- Grow your familiarity with the social and economic influences of mobile computing
- Understand the guidelines and techniques of mobile application design, development, and deployment
- Discover how to analyze, design, develop, write, test, and deploy mobile applications into a target platform environment
